Output ec874c705dd3a1bdc4c8e5912b48b26a955beebade322213c832c2a2edb27aab:0

value
99628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66df1503385a6d7456a345ba9b57b3fa1f754c7f OP_EQUAL
address
3B4x68DD48R74vqNJUUPihGtcfZ7L16v9i
transaction
ec874c705dd3a1bdc4c8e5912b48b26a955beebade322213c832c2a2edb27aab